Use el/la/los/las + de + [noun] or el/la/los/las + que + [verb] to refer to people or things based on some other point of reference: jorge es el del resturante cubano. Jorge is the man from the cuban resturante. The definite article must agree with the gender and number of the people: gabriela y elena son las que trabajan en la liber a.
